The layout of a professional “Sorry You’re Leaving Card” template should be clean, uncluttered, and easy to read. Consider these key elements:

Vertical or Horizontal Orientation: Choose a format that best suits your content and branding. Vertical orientation is often preferred for a more formal look, while horizontal orientation can be used for a more casual or creative approach.

  • White Space: Ample white space around the text and graphics creates a sense of balance and readability. Avoid overcrowding the card with too many elements.
  • Alignment: Align text and graphics consistently to enhance the overall appearance. Left-alignment is generally considered the most professional choice.
  • Typography: Select fonts that are easy to read and complement your brand’s style. Avoid using too many different fonts or font sizes.
  • Color Scheme: Choose a color scheme that is visually appealing and reflects your brand’s personality. Consider using a combination of neutral colors (e.g., black, white, gray) with a few accent colors to create interest.

  • Design Elements

    To convey professionalism and trust, incorporate the following design elements into your “Sorry You’re Leaving Card” template:

    Company Logo: Place the company logo prominently in a recognizable location, such as the top left or right corner. This helps to reinforce the company’s identity and establishes credibility.

  • Personalized Message: Include a personalized message that expresses your appreciation for the departing employee’s contributions. This can be a simple sentence or a more detailed paragraph.
  • Departing Employee’s Name and Title: Clearly display the departing employee’s name and title. This ensures that the card is addressed to the correct person.
  • Date: Indicate the date of the card to show that it is timely and relevant.
  • Signature Line: Provide a signature line for the sender’s name and title. This adds a personal touch and makes the card more authentic.
  • Contact Information: If appropriate, include contact information for the company or the sender. This allows the departing employee to stay in touch if desired.

  • Visual Elements

    Visual elements can enhance the overall appeal of your “Sorry You’re Leaving Card” template. Consider incorporating the following:

    Background Image: A subtle background image can add a touch of visual interest without distracting from the main content. Choose an image that is relevant to the company or the departing employee’s role.

  • Graphics: Use simple graphics or icons to illustrate key points or themes. Avoid using overly complex or cluttered graphics that can detract from the overall design.
  • Borders: A subtle border can help to frame the content and create a more polished look. Choose a border style that complements the overall design.

  • Additional Considerations

    Card Material: Choose a high-quality card material that is durable and professional. Consider using a thicker cardstock for a more substantial feel.

  • Envelope: Select an envelope that matches the card’s size and style. A plain white envelope is often a safe choice.
  • Printing: Ensure that the card is printed using high-quality equipment and inks. This will help to create a professional and polished appearance.

  • By carefully considering these design elements and incorporating them into your “Sorry You’re Leaving Card” template, you can create a visually appealing and meaningful card that conveys your appreciation for the departing employee’s contributions.
